New compact and noncompact solutions of the K(k,n) equations

Mustafa Inc

Chaos, Solitons & Fractals, 2006, vol. 29, issue 4, 895-903

Abstract: In this paper, we establish exact solutions for the K(k,n) equations. A new sn–cn method is used for obtaining traveling wave solutions for this equation with minimal calculations. As a result, abundant new compactons: solitons with the absence of infinite wings, solitary wave and periodic wave solutions of this equation is obtained. The properties of the K(k,n) equations are shown in figures.
